What are Neodymium Magnets?
Neodymium magnets undoubtedly are a variety of uncommon earth magnet, renowned for his or her Remarkable energy and magnetic properties. Composed principally of neodymium, iron, and boron (NdFeB), these magnets possess the best magnetic Electricity of any commercially offered product. Their extraordinary strength and compact sizing make them indispensable in a wide array of programs where sturdy magnetic fields are necessary.

Houses of Neodymium Magnets:

Remarkable Energy: Neodymium magnets would be the strongest variety of long term magnet offered, effective at exerting incredibly powerful magnetic fields.
Large Magnetic Flux Density: These magnets exhibit significant magnetic flux density, this means they are able to bring in ferromagnetic materials with amazing drive.
Compact Dimension: Even with their energy, neodymium magnets are rather little and light-weight, generating them perfect for programs wherever House is limited.
Temperature Sensitivity: Neodymium magnets have reduce working temperatures when compared to other permanent magnets, with a few grades dealing with general performance degradation at elevated temperatures.
Applications of Neodymium Magnets:
The versatility and toughness of neodymium magnets make them indispensable in a wide array of industries and programs, which includes:

Electronics: Neodymium magnets are used in speakers, headphones, microphones, and magnetic sensors, maximizing general performance and miniaturization.
Renewable Energy: Wind turbines and electric motors benefit from neodymium magnets to crank out clear Strength far more successfully.
Automotive Engineering: Electrical automobiles (EVs) and hybrid vehicles depend on neodymium magnets in motors, energy steering methods, and regenerative braking units.
Professional medical Units: Magnetic resonance imaging (MRI) machines, health care implants, and diagnostic products reap the benefits of the precision and trustworthiness of neodymium magnets.
